Holiday Garlic Mashed Potatoes Recipe


This mashed potatoes recipe is perfect for large family gatherings. Services 25-30 hungry guests!

This is a perfect recipe to prepare ahead, or you can make it the day of. It serves 25-30 hungry people. These mashed potatoes are a perfect pairing with your favourite gravy too!




Ingredients:


-15 pounds of Ontario white potatoes

-1 ½ cups of sour cream

- 1 brick of cream cheese

-1/2 cup of butter

-3 cloves Ontario garlic

-2 tbsp of parsley flakes (optional)

-1 cup of grated or shredded parmesan cheese for topping

Directions:


1. Wash and peel potatoes, then dice into cubes. Place potatoes in large cooking pot, add garlic cloves, and cover with cold water. Bring potatoes to a gentle boil and cook for 15-20 minutes until tender. Drain potatoes and garlic, then return to a warm pot, or mixing bowl.


2. Add sour cream, cream cheese, butter, and parsley flakes to the potatoes. Mash slightly to break the potatoes up.


3. Give your arm a break and beat potatoes with an electric mixer at medium speed until smooth and fluffy.


4. Once well mixed, spoon potatoes into large casserole dish evenly and top with parmesan cheese.*


5. Let cool for 10 min before serving.


*If your making potatoes a day ahead; let them cool, then cover and put in fridge for next day serving. Put them in the oven an hour before dinner at 350F for 45min-1hr until golden brown on top.
